Les Souvenirs Sous Ma Frange, the eagerly awaited second album by Rose, finds the French pop darling stretching out as a songwriter and experimenting with different musical arrangements. There's plenty to enjoy, particularly for fans looking forward to her artistic development, yet Les Souvenirs Sous Ma Frange is just as likely to alienate some of her audience, particularly those hoping for another album of perfectly crafted hit singles like her first. The eponymous album debut of Rose was something of a French pop sensation. When it was initially released in 2006, it fell on deaf ears for the most part. Some critics were quick to trumpet the album and some keen-eared listeners were quick to champion the lead single, "La Liste," but it wasn't until 2007 that the album found a mass audience, once Rose began touring around France and the follow-up single, "Ciao Bella," started getting heavy airplay. Rose eventually broke into the Top Five of the French albums chart in late 2007 and sold well enough to chart for another year's time. It was an album that had something for everyone, a couple catchy singles for radio listeners and a jazzy second half for those looking for something a bit more challenging. On her full-length follow-up effort, Les Souvenirs Sous Ma Frange, Rose once again starts off the album with a few immediately likable pop songs ("Comment d'Était Déjà," "Chez Moi," "Yes We Did") before veering off into more challenging material. The fourth song, "De Ma Fenêtre," is where the album starts getting unpredictable and increasingly orchestral. The instrumentation varies from song to song, and while some are graced with nice melodies, "Ne Partez Pas" and "Ma Corde au Clou" in particular, others are more difficult, showcasing Rose's growing ambitions as an experimentalist. The problem with Les Souvenirs Sous Ma Frange that some listeners will have is that the album-opening pop songs unfortunately fall way short of those on her debut album, and the album tracks that follow are more experimental this time than before. This shouldn't detract those drawn to Rose herself, as her artistic development is in full bloom here, but those who were drawn to her hit singles rather than the singer/songwriter herself are likely to be disappointed by the less accessible direction in which she heads on Les Souvenirs Sous Ma Frange.
© Jason Birchmeier /TiVo
